Microsoft Windows 2000 Service Pack 2 (see note below) Note
that Windows 2000 Service Pack 2 breaks the IP stack for CheckPoint
Firewall-1/VPN-1 and requires application of Firewall-1/VPN-1 Service Pack
4. CA
InoculateIT 4.x signature files are currently at version 25.32 (7/2/2001)
and McAfee VirusScan/NetShield is at version 4146 (7/4/2001). Please keep your antivirus signatures current!

IT functions and your business. This
month, an area of concern I’d like to discuss is DSL.
DSL technology has been a wonderful boost to the IT industry,
bringing reasonably priced (if not in fact cheap!) always-up Internet
access to small and mid-sized businesses across the country.
It has been a major driver for expanding Internet mail, increasing
the richness of multimedia content on the Internet, and from QTS’
perspective has been a major driver for our QuikAlert product and our
remote network management services. So,
one might say, where is the problem? Fortunately,
only a handful of our clients were impacted by Northpoint’s bankruptcy,
and the dissolution of its DSL network.
As you may know, Northpoint was one of the three major CLECs
driving the DSL growth-frenzy. The
CLECs are the critical “glue” between ISPs and the circuits themselves
(provided by Verizon or the local Bell company).
All three companies (the ISP, the CLEC, and the telephone company)
need to work together and provide components of the DSL solution –
making DSL a challenging technology to implement in many cases.
Failure on the part of any one of these key components of the
solution brings down the service, and with it Internet access for impacted
businesses. Hence,
the problem. Northpoint’s
bankruptcy, concurrent with a continuing shake-out in the ISP realm
(including victims like PSInet), may be the tip of the iceberg.
Rumors have been flying for the past few months that the other two
CLECs, Covad and Rhythms, are in equally challenging financial straits.
Both companies insist that, though still in red ink, they are on
the path to profitability. Only time will tell. But
it raises the specter of possible future problems – imagine the impact
of Covad suffering the same fate as Northpoint, and over 55% of all DSL
users suddenly losing their connection to the Internet! What
is one to do? Cable modems
provide fast performance, but there are cons as well as pros to this
technology. From my perspective, this isn’t really a strong
business-class solution, based on the shared nature of the bandwidth and
the security issues associated with it.
If the Internet is a critical component of your IT infrastructure,
which it is for most of our clients, then this is an issue you need to
consider. A positive side-effect of DSL has been the driving of T1
pricing down to all-time low levels – from around $2,000 per month a few
years ago, to in some cases below $1,000 per month these days (but, caveat
emptor, you do get what you pay for here!).
If Internet connectivity is critical to your business, and you are
running DSL, you should be considering at what point you’ll look to make
the jump to a T1 or fractional T1. It
will absolutely be more expensive, but it will be more reliable and will
come with a Service Level Agreement (SLA) commitment from the ISP.
You don’t, and won’t, have that with DSL, because the
technology is inherently less reliable. Feel

redeploy IT resources. By
way of background, AFS is the most experienced student exchange
organization in the world. In response to the humanitarian crises of World
Wars I and II, more than 2,500 young Americans volunteered as American
Field Service ambulance drivers on the front lines of battle. Following WW
II, the drivers resolved to find a way to build understanding between
nations by educating enlightened world leaders through international
student exchanges, and, in 1947, founded AFS. Today,
AFS exchanges more than 10,000 participants each year. In addition to
being the most experienced student exchange organization, AFS is also one
of the world's largest volunteer organizations. With 270,000 AFS alumni
